What is photosynthesis?

Back

Photosynthesis is the process by which green plants, algae, and some bacteria convert light energy into chemical energy in the form of glucose, using carbon dioxide and water.

What is cellular respiration?

Back

Cellular respiration is the process by which cells convert glucose and oxygen into energy (ATP), carbon dioxide, and water.

What is a food web?

Back

A food web is a complex network of feeding relationships among organisms in an ecosystem, showing how energy and nutrients flow through the system.

What role do producers play in an ecosystem?

Back

Producers, such as plants, create their own food through photosynthesis and serve as the base of the food web.

What are decomposers?

Back

Decomposers are organisms, such as fungi and bacteria, that break down dead organic matter, returning nutrients to the soil.
